Commercial Property (Former First Union Bank Building)
216 North Main St.Graham, NC 27253
Approximately 10,000 +/- sf. Of interior space, 6180 sf. main level, 4,000 sf. upper level – Brick and concrete structure – Approximately 50 dedicated parking spaces – Building features a 3 position drive through teller station, restroom facilities on both levels, interior office space (partitioned as well as private, executive conference rooms, teller stations, fully operational interior bank vault, safety deposit vault with boxes still operational, (2) additional fire proof document rooms, large upper level production room.
Building is situated on approximately .562 acres
This property located in a high traffic area with front entrance to Main street – Convenient to downtown Graham and Interstate 85/40 – Only 2 blocks from Alamance County Courthouse –
